SEO Optimization Made Simple: Tips for Small Business Owners

MOtxt

For small business owners looking to boost their online presence and increase their website traffic, search engine optimization, or SEO, is an strategy to master. While SEO may seem daunting and complicated, it can actually be quite simple with the right tips and strategies in place. By implementing these simple SEO optimization techniques, small business owners can improve their search engine rankings and attract more potential customers to their website.

1. Use Relevant Keywords: Keywords are the foundation of SEO, as they are what search engines use to determine the relevance of a website to a user’s query. Small business owners should conduct keyword research to identify the most relevant and high-volume keywords in their industry. Once these keywords are identified, they should be strategically placed throughout the website, including in headings, meta tags, and content.

2. Optimize Website Content: In addition to using relevant keywords, small business owners should also focus on creating high-, valuable content for their website. This not only helps to engage visitors and keep them on the site longer, but it also signals to search engines that the website is a valuable resource. Regularly updating and adding new content can also help improve search engine rankings.

3. Improve Website Speed ​​and User Experience: Website speed and user experience are also important factors in SEO optimization. Search engines prioritize websites that load quickly and provide a seamless user experience. Small business owners should optimize their website for speed, by reducing image sizes, eliminating unnecessary plugins, and leveraging browser caching. Additionally, they should ensure that their website is easy to navigate and -friendly.

4. Build High- Backlinks: Backlinks are links from other websites that point back to your website. These links are an important factor in SEO, as they signal to search engines that your website is a valuable and credible resource. Small business owners should focus on building high- backlinks from reputable websites in their industry. This can be done through guest blogging, content partnerships, and social media promotion.

5. and Analyze Performance: Finally, small business owners should regularly and analyze their website’s performance to identify areas for improvement. Tools like Google Analytics can provide valuable insights into website traffic, user behavior, and conversion rates. By tracking these metrics, small business owners can make data-driven decisions to improve their SEO strategy and drive more traffic to their website.
